Salary of Biomedical Engineering Graduates with a Bachelor’s Degree

$67,733 Bachelor's Median Salary

Biomedical Engineering majors who earn their bachelor’s degree from City report a median salary of $67,733 a year. This is above $61,249, the median for all majors at City.

Bachelor’s Student Diversity

In the most recent graduating class, 36% of biomedical engineering bachelor’s degrees went to men and 64% went to women.

City gender breakdown of Biomedical Engineering Bachelor's degree grads The majority of biomedical engineering bachelor’s degree graduates at City are Asian. Roughly 32% of graduates fell into this category.
